This position is 40 hours, Weekday, Day Shift. The Advanced Practice Provider delivers operational and professional management for a small to medium-sized team of Advanced Practice Providers (APPs) and allied health professionals. This role balances hands-on patient care with leadership responsibilities, ensuring safe, efficient, and high-quality delivery of specialized imaging and stress-testing services within the Nuclear Cardiology Molecular Imaging department.
Does This Position Provide Direct Patient Care? Yes
Essential Functions:
- Leadership and Staff Management:
- Provides direct management and accountability for a team of APPs and/or allied health professionals.
- Recruits, hires, onboards, orients, and mentors APP staff.
- Conducts performance evaluations, coaching, and professional development planning.
- Works closely with APP Lead to develop staffing schedules to support clinical volumes and operational needs.
- Clinical Practice:
- Provides patient care oversight as a Nurse Practitioner in Nuclear Cardiology and Molecular Imaging.
- Oversees pre-procedure evaluations, risk stratification, and patient education for nuclear stress testing, PET/CT, PET/MR, and SPECT imaging.
- Collaborates with attending physicians on clinical decision-making, documentation, and care coordination.
- Gains clinical competency in radiopharmaceuticals, stress agents, and imaging-related protocols.
- Quality, Safety, and Compliance:
- Supports quality assurance and continuous quality improvement initiatives.
- Ensures adherence to institutional policies, regulatory standards, and patient safety practices.
- Oversees compliance with documentation and APP billing requirements.
- Participates in incident reviews, root-cause analyses, and corrective action planning.
- Education and Professional Development:
- Ensures ongoing education, competency validation, and clinical training for APP staff.
- Supports teaching and mentorship of trainees and new hires.
- Encourages continuing education and specialty certification.
- Collaboration and Communication:
- Acts as a liaison between APPs, physicians, technologists, nursing, operations, and leadership.
- Collaborates to optimize workflow efficiency, patient throughput, and care coordination.
- Contributes to service line planning and operational initiatives.
The Ideal Candidate will have:
- Prior APP Management experience, strongly preferred.
- Demonstrated leadership or supervisory experience.
- Knowledge of quality, safety, and regulatory standards in procedural or imaging environments.
- Experience with nuclear medicine or molecular imaging workflows.
- Familiarity with APP billing and compliance requirements.

Mass General Brigham Competency Framework
At Mass General Brigham, our competency framework defines what effective leadership "looks like" by specifying which behaviors are most critical for successful performance at each job level. The framework is comprised of ten competencies (half People-Focused, half Performance-Focused) and are defined by observable and measurable skills and behaviors that contribute to workplace effectiveness and career success. These competencies are used to evaluate performance, make hiring decisions, identify development needs, mobilize employees across our system, and establish a strong talent pipeline.
